The 2023 Classic Men's Fours began on Saturday and concluded Sunday afternoon with three rounds per day.
16 teams from all around Queensland competed for the great prize money on offer.
Tournament organisers Terry Clarke, Bob McMahon and Tim Taylor can be very proud of their efforts.
The team of Manny Isgro, Tim Taylor, Bob Menzies and Paul Foot took home the prize money with a clear margin with Gavin Milne's team of Toby Craig, John Bye and Scott Hamilton all from Proserpine take home the second prize money .
Peter Blackburn from South Suburban with Dave Peet, Barry Jackson and Jason Borg took home the third prize money cheque.
